Meet John & Donna — Continuing the Story of Potager

Potager – A Kitchen Garden is guided by John and Donna Spedding. Their story is woven through the Tweed hinterland, which John has always called home.   John is a fifth-generation Tweed local, born in Murwillumbah, with family ties to the Burringbar Bakery, banana farms, cattle, small crops and commercial fishing. His grandfather also served as a Tweed Shire councillor, deepening the family’s connection to the region. Donna didn’t grow up in the Tweed—she was raised on the Wide Bay, surrounded by sugar cane, cattle and horses, sparking a lifelong love of the land and nature.   Outside of work and raising their three boys, Donna led community nature days and helped establish butterfly gardens for locals and children—hands-on projects that encouraged connection with the natural world and an appreciation for sustainability.   Our love of travel & experiences   Time overseas also gave us a deep love of travel and the kinds of experiences that spark conversation and bring stories back to the table with family and friends.
